Finding High-ROI Automation Opportunities

A practical framework for identifying automation investments that deliver measurable returns.

Automation promises significant returns, but most organizations automate the wrong things first. Executives approve initiatives based on enthusiasm or vendor pitches rather than rigorous opportunity analysis. The result is capital deployed against low-impact processes while high-value targets remain untouched. Finding high return on investment (ROI) automation opportunities requires a disciplined method, not intuition.

Why Most Automation Programs Underdeliver

Organizations frequently automate processes that are visible rather than valuable. A finance team automates invoice formatting while manual reconciliation consumes forty hours per week. An operations team deploys robotic process automation (RPA) on data entry while exception handling—the real bottleneck—stays manual. These decisions feel productive but generate marginal returns.

The core problem is the absence of a structured discovery process. Without one, teams default to automating what is easy to describe, not what is costly to run. High-ROI opportunities sit in processes that are high-frequency, rule-based, error-prone and directly tied to revenue or cost. Most organizations never map their processes against these four criteria simultaneously.

The Four Criteria That Define High-ROI Targets

A process qualifies as a high-ROI automation target when it meets four conditions. First, it runs at high frequency—daily or multiple times per day. Second, it follows deterministic rules with limited judgment required. Third, errors in the process carry measurable financial consequences. Fourth, the process connects directly to a revenue stream or a significant cost center.

Frequency matters because automation amortizes its fixed cost across every execution. A process running ten thousand times per month generates ten thousand units of return. A process running twice per month generates almost none. Rule-based logic matters because automation handles structured decisions reliably but fails on ambiguous ones. Error cost matters because automation eliminates rework, penalties and customer churn. Revenue or cost linkage matters because it makes the return calculable and defensible to a board.

When a process satisfies all four criteria, the ROI case becomes straightforward. When it satisfies only two or three, the investment requires deeper scrutiny.

Mapping Processes to Financial Impact

The discovery phase must connect process data to financial data. This requires collaboration between operations, finance and technology teams. Operations teams know where time goes. Finance teams know what time costs. Technology teams know what is automatable. Without all three perspectives, the opportunity map is incomplete.

Start with a time-and-motion analysis across the highest-cost functions. Identify the top ten processes by labor hours consumed per month. For each process, calculate the fully loaded cost per execution—including labor, error remediation and downstream delays. Then rank them by total monthly cost. This ranking surfaces the real targets, not the assumed ones.

A global logistics company following this method discovered that its carrier invoice dispute process consumed more labor hours than its entire customer onboarding workflow. The dispute process was invisible to leadership because it sat inside accounts payable. Automating it reduced processing time by sixty percent and eliminated a recurring source of supplier relationship friction.

Separating Quick Wins from Strategic Bets

Not all high-ROI opportunities carry the same implementation complexity. Executives must distinguish between quick wins and strategic bets. Quick wins are high-frequency, low-complexity processes that existing tools can automate within weeks. Strategic bets are high-value processes that require custom development, integration work or change management over months.

Quick wins build organizational confidence and fund further investment. Strategic bets transform competitive position. A mature automation program pursues both in parallel, sequencing quick wins to generate early returns while strategic bets move through longer development cycles.

The mistake organizations make is treating all automation as equivalent. They apply enterprise-grade governance to a simple RPA script and stall momentum. They apply quick-win timelines to a complex machine learning (ML) integration and create technical debt. Matching governance to complexity is as important as identifying the opportunity itself.

Quantifying the Return Before Committing Capital

Every automation opportunity must carry a financial model before receiving capital approval. The model should include four components: current process cost, projected post-automation cost, implementation cost and payback period. Current process cost equals labor hours multiplied by fully loaded hourly rate, plus error remediation cost. Projected post-automation cost equals residual human oversight plus maintenance. Implementation cost includes software licensing, development, testing and change management. Payback period equals implementation cost divided by monthly savings.

A payback period under twelve months signals a strong candidate. A payback period between twelve and twenty-four months requires strategic justification. Beyond twenty-four months, the opportunity needs exceptional strategic value to proceed.

This model forces rigor. It prevents teams from advancing opportunities based on enthusiasm alone. It also creates accountability—when the automation goes live, actual performance can be measured against the model.

Avoiding the Complexity Trap

Some processes look like automation candidates but carry hidden complexity. They appear rule-based on the surface but contain dozens of exceptions handled informally by experienced staff. Automating these processes without surfacing the exceptions first creates brittle systems that fail in production.

Before committing to automation, map the exception rate. If more than fifteen percent of process instances require human judgment, the process is not ready for full automation. It may be a candidate for human-in-the-loop automation, where software handles the standard path and humans handle exceptions. This hybrid model still delivers significant returns while avoiding the fragility of over-automation.

Process mining tools help surface exception rates objectively. They analyze system logs to reconstruct actual process flows, revealing the gap between the documented process and the real one. Organizations that skip this step frequently discover the gap only after deployment, at much higher cost.

Building an Automation Opportunity Pipeline

High-ROI automation is not a one-time exercise. It requires a standing pipeline of evaluated opportunities ranked by expected return. This pipeline feeds the annual capital planning cycle and ensures that automation investment decisions compete on equal terms with other capital allocation choices.

The pipeline should be owned by a cross-functional team with representation from finance, operations and technology. It should be reviewed quarterly. New opportunities enter through a standardized intake process. Existing opportunities are re-ranked as business conditions change. This discipline prevents the pipeline from becoming a wish list and keeps it connected to current business priorities.

Organizations that maintain a live pipeline allocate automation capital more effectively than those that run periodic discovery projects. The pipeline creates institutional knowledge about process costs and automation feasibility that compounds over time.

Summary

Finding high-ROI automation opportunities is a capital allocation discipline, not a technology exercise. It requires mapping processes to financial impact, applying four rigorous selection criteria and building financial models before committing resources. Organizations that treat automation discovery as a structured process consistently outperform those that automate opportunistically. The competitive advantage lies not in the technology itself but in the method used to identify where it creates the most value.
